Global creative agency 72andSunny has made six new appointments to its Sydney team.
Joining the Sydney office is strategy director Joel Pearson, who commences with the agency after his previous role as a planning director at TBWA Sydney.

Prior to his two year stint, Pearson was the head of digital and innovation at media agency PHD.

Commencing with 72andSunny as a brand director is Annalise Dry. Dry joins the agency from her previous role as an account director at Clemenger BBDO Melbourne.
Greg Fyson has started with the agency as an executive producer, meanwhile Mark Carbon has been appointed to the role of senior writer while Alice Child becomes a senior brand manager.
Molly Mohr also joins the agency as a brand manager.
The six new hires come four months after Micah Walker joined 72andSunny Sydney as an executive creative director.
72andSunny also picked up a spot on Optus’ creative roster earlier in the year and won the creative account for Paspaley Retail.
